Emergency Water Extraction

When your home is flooded, every minute counts. Our team will quickly extract the water and begin the drying process to prevent further damage. This involves using powerful pumps and specialized equipment to remove standing water and moisture from your home’s surfaces.

Structural Drying Process

After water extraction, our team will begin the structural drying process to dry out your home’s walls, floors, and ceilings. This involves using specialized equipment to circulate warm air and speed up the evaporation process, ensuring your home is dry and safe to occupy.

Moisture Detection and Monitoring

Our team will use specialized equipment to detect and monitor moisture levels in your home, ensuring that all areas are dry and free from hidden water damage. This is crucial to preventing mold growth and further damage.

Emergency Damage Restoration Cost In The 2889 Area

The cost of emergency damage restoration can vary widely depending on the severity and size of the damage, as well as local conditions in the 2889 area. For example, a small water leak on a tile floor may need only a mop and bucket, while a major storm damage may need specialized equipment and expertise to clear debris and restore power. We’ll provide a free estimate for your specific situation, so you know exactly what to expect.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, amount of water damage
Structural Drying Process $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, complexity of drying process
Moisture Detection and Monitoring $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, complexity of moisture detection process
Sewage Cleanup $1,500 – $6,000 Size of affected area, complexity of cleanup process
Basement Flood Recovery $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, complexity of recovery process
Mold Remediation $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, complexity of remediation process
